In this article we will discuss the top 10 best currency pairs to trade, there are many currency pairs in the foreign exchange market, some currency pairs have great directionality, and some currencies have great volatility, but they remain unchanged for a period of time. Some currency pairs react very strongly to high-impact economic newswhile others remain calm. There is no correct answer as to which currency pair is best for traders and which is the best forex pairs to trade.


In order to choose the best foreign exchange currency pair, we must consider volatility, spreads, trading strategy, leveragerisk, and money management. There are many types of currency pairs that can be traded on the foreign exchange market.

Since Australia is an exporter, the Australian dollar fluctuates with the price of commodities such as iron ore and coal. Falling commodity prices usually put pressure on what is the best curency pairs for forex Australian dollar, what is the best curency pairs for forex rising commodity prices make the Australian dollar stronger.


The difference in interest rates between the Reserve Bank of Australia RBA and the Federal Reserve Fed will also affect the value of these currencies.
